2008 International Technology Transfer Forum, Binhai Declaration
 2008 International Technology Transfer Forum (Tianjin, China), jointly sponsored by the Torch High Technology Industry Development Center of the Ministry of Science and Technology of the People¡¯s Republic of China, Administrative Commission of Tianjin Binhai New Area and Tianjin Municipal Science and Technology Commission, has convened ceremoniously in Tianjin Binhai New Area. With the theme of ¡°Technology Transfer: Globalization and Innovation¡±, the Forum has served as a platform facilitating exchanges and cooperation and provided an opportunity for development, enabling the participants to have extensive and in-depth discussions that prove to be successful in building consensus among them.

As an important aspect of the self-innovation strategy of China, technology transfer is to the enterprise a key link in its endeavor to innovate and sharpen its competitive edge, and constitutes a major means of translating scientific and technological achievements into productive forces. Building a new technology transfer system and exploring for an operational mechanism that facilitates technology transfer and proliferation is a pressing strategic task in the drive of building an innovation-oriented country. And the building of such a new technology transfer system ¨C one that would meet the demands for enterprise innovation, with universities and scientific research institutions as the base and technology transfer service providers as the link, thus integrating production and scientific research ¨C is a task of top priority in the development of technology transfer.
2. A sound pro-innovation climate and an effective law and policy system would help promote the development of technology transfer. The implementation of the national technology transfer promotion action plan has brought about a better technology transfer environment, a more complete national and regional technology transfer system, and more active knowledge flow and technology transfer between production and research, and between sectors, fields of disciplines, regions or countries. In the face of the golden opportunity for technology transfer development, we should make the most of it by adopting effective and workable measures conducive to greater development of technology transfer.

3. It¡¯s always imperative to further emancipate our mind. And innovation is a never-ending challenge. Having the whole world in view, we should learn and introduce the advanced experiences and concepts of other countries, make use of all resources available, foster our unique features, and adopt new thinking, new systems and new mechanisms conducive to our greater comprehensive strength, sharper innovative edge, better services and greater competitiveness. The forum has called on the government authorities, regional technology leagues and the enterprises and research institutions concerned to strengthen contact and exchanges between them and join hands in creating a new situation for technology transfer.
4. An experimental area for the country¡¯s comprehensive reform drive, the Binhai New Area promises better opportunities for innovation initiatives and technology transfer, for a number of prestigious domestic and international enterprises, research institutions and service providers have come to Binhai New Area for business and service. The convening of the forum will definitely help propel the development of technology transfer in the area and in Tianjin as well.

It is the hope of all the participants that this international technology transfer forum will be held regularly in the years to come, to ensure the sustained development of technology transfer.
